Current undergraduate medical school curricular trends focus on both vertical integration of clinical knowledge into the traditionally basic science‐dedicated curricula and increasing basic science education in the clinical years. This latter type of integration is more difficult and less reported on than the former. Here, we present an outline of a course wherein the primary learning and teaching objective is to integrate basic science anatomy knowledge with clinical education. The course was developed through collaboration by a multi‐specialist course development team (composed of both basic scientists and physicians) and was founded in current adult learning theories. The course was designed to be widely applicable to multiple future specialties, using current published reports regarding the topics and clinical care areas relying heavily on anatomical knowledge regardless of specialist focus. To this end, the course focuses on the role of anatomy in the diagnosis and treatment of frequently encountered musculoskeletal conditions. Our iterative implementation and action research approach to this course development has yielded a curricular template for anatomy integration into clinical years. Key components for successful implementation of these types of courses, including content topic sequence, the faculty development team, learning approaches, and hidden curricula, were developed. We also report preliminary feedback from course stakeholders and lessons learned through the process. The purpose of this report is to enhance the current literature regarding basic science integration in the clinical years of medical school. How do public libraries develop their collections of high-demand materials for the “I want it now” generation? Ten public libraries’ holdings of fiction and nonfiction bestseller titles were observed over a four-week period. The number of copies rose fairly consistently, with the five fiction titles having roughly about twice the number of copies as the five nonfiction titles. The ratio of holds to copies averaged 2.7:1 and ranged from 0.8:1 to 6.5:1. Demand for e-books was consistently higher than the number of copies available, averaging more than 4:1 across all libraries.  相似文献

This chapter discusses the role conflict of the educational researcher who comes upon an unprofessional relationship between teacher and pupil. It is argued that the whistleblowing literature in related professions, with its focus on standard conditions and solutions framed as obligations, is inadequate. Reference is made to the idea of 'guilty knowledge': the feelings of guilt that attach when one comes to know of harm visited on innocent others, and has no unqualified sense of which way to act. Distinguishing moral from causal responsibility helps to show how blame need not necessarily attach to the guilt-ridden researcher, whichever option she chooses.  相似文献

This study compares the instrumentation and analysis techniques used when determining the power expended pedalling a rope-braked ergometer manufactured by Monark (Sweden) during a low intensity test. Power values were generated by eight subjects. The instrumentation consisted of load cells to measure the rope brake forces, a tachometer to measure the flywheel velocity and instrumented pedal cranks manufactured by Schoberer Rad Messtechnik (SRM). The subjects pedalled a rope-braked ergometer at 60 rev min-1, against a resistance of 3 kg, for 5 minutes. Three different measurements of the mean power were recorded and these were compared with the value given by Monark. The SRM cranks provided two sets of results using different software packages supplied with the cranks. SRM standard software is used for taking measurements during training and cycle races over long time periods. An additional piece of software is provided by SRM called Ptnew, which gives readings of torque and pedal cadence over periods up to 30 seconds. Using the values supplied by Monark each subject generated 180 W of power. The mean power for the eight subjects, measured using the SRM cranks, was 170.36 W (SD 4.11) using the alternative SRM software (Ptnew) over a 30 second period and 173.68 W (SD 2.21) using the standard SRM software. From the direct measurement of the brake forces and flywheel velocity the mean power across the eight subjects was 148.90 W (SD 5.89). The SRM cranks measure the input power, whereas the direct measurement system measures the power output excluding mechanical losses. These values give a figure for the mechanical efficiency for the roped-braked ergometer of 88%. It was found that Monark overestimates the power generated by the subjects when compared with both the SRM systems and the direct measurement instrumentation.  相似文献

This article examines musical taste, as revealed by the Cultural Capital and Social Exclusion survey. It shows that musical taste is highly divided and contentious, with large numbers of people intensely disliking certain genres of music. It shows the existence of two distinctive musical taste communities, one linking taste for rock, electronic, urban, world and heavy metal music, and the other linking classical music and jazz. Tastes for specific musical works do not easily map onto musical genres, and are less closely correlated with each other. Using logistic regression, it is shown that age and ethnicity in particular, and gender, educational qualifications and occupational class, strongly condition taste for both musical genres and works.  相似文献
